Assume two power plants provide power to all of Central Connecticut: a power plant run by Turtle Power Co. and a power plant run by Ranger Power Co. Both power plants burn coal to produce electricity and produce smog as a by-product. The Turtle power plant can reduce its smog by Xy units at a marginal cost of MC (XT) = 10X7. The Ranger power plant is less efficient and can reduce its smog by Xp units at a marginal cost of MCR(Xr) = 15XR + 10. A team of environmental consultants calculate the marginal benefit of a reduction in pollution to equal 100. a. What is the socially optimal level of pollution abatement for each power plant? b. Connecticut is considering imposing a tax on power production to reduce smog. i. What tax should it impose to reach the abatement levels you calculated in part a? ii. What level of pollution abatement will each firm choose under this tax? c. Suppose that connecticut tries to reduce pollution through by mandating a reduction in smog for all power plants. Given that the state cannot pass a law with individual requirements for each firm, it requires each firm to reduce pollution by X = 8 units per year. i. Does this lead to the optimal level of pollution reduction? ii. Is it an efficient means to reduce pollution? Explain. iii. Would the outcome or efficiency change if Connecticut allowed pollution permits to be traded between Turtle Power Co. and Ranger Power Co.? Explain.
